Rosé Brut
N.V., dry
Austrian sparkling wine from Loidesthal, Niederösterreich
Delicate rosé, fine -beaded, complex on the nose, intense red berries, some nut nougat, fruity on the palate, very fresh, creamy mousseux, great yeast touch, stays on for a long time.

Details of the wine
Varieties: Pinot Noir
Block(s): around Loidesthal & Blumenthal
Soil: calcareous löss
Vinification
Pinot Noir grapes are hand harvested at the ideal ripeness point into small boxes following by gently whole bunch pressing. The wine matures for ten months in stainless steel tanks and big oak casks. After bottling for second fermentation, it is resting for 30 month on the lees, which contributes to the creamy texture. Hand riddled and disgorged on our estate.
Food Pairing
Aperitif, Fish, White meat
